Output 210e2c9c8bc8e53bb5b29235d12011bf302904b434242d2f9fcec3e41ec9d072:2

value
39400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b0aba7bb57648243b424312a9637a5972bc9284 OP_EQUAL
address
3CubtZhqUAAD6gXYpa1vq82WrZH3JBWF9H
transaction
210e2c9c8bc8e53bb5b29235d12011bf302904b434242d2f9fcec3e41ec9d072
confirmations
501019
spent
true